RAMA, Claudio. The third generation of distance education regulations in Latin America. Rev. Diálogo Educ. [online]. 2017, vol.17, n.54, pp.1085-1124.  Epub Feb 26, 2020. ISSN 1981-416X.  https://doi.org/10.7213/1981-416x.17.054.ds02.

This article is a comparative analysis of the new regulatory regulations for distance higher education in Latin America, developed since 2010, in particular those of Ecuador, Argentina, Peru, Brazil, Paraguay, Costa Rica and The Savior. The work tends to evaluate the general evolution trends of remote regulatory frameworks, showing the dualities of progress and setbacks, and identifying the new inclusion of 100% virtual offers and more flexible systems in their management. The article seeks to identify the common and differentiating axes of these third generation regulations and associated with it of the differentiation of their higher education systems and makes a classification of the phases of the regulations of distance education in the region.
